WebOct 11, 2024 · The following are the top remedies for chili pepper burns on the skin, such as hands, fingers, arms, etc. #1 Friend, Milk. The best method for chili pepper burn in the mouth is also the best for the skin. To relieve the pain, pour a bowl of cold milk and place your hands in the milk for a few minutes to feel significant relief. WebApr 13, 2024 · Stir the ingredients together until well combined.
